Examine This Report on what is api mean

API portals are utilized to find and share published API patterns. Developers need to discover the API technical specs to understand if an API may also help them And the way it should be employed. The portals for community APIs (i.e., APIs that are created accessible for buyers from other organizations and infrequently visible to the internet) tend to be embedded inside a web site of supporting substance which include authorized stipulations.

They're used to authorize people to produce the API phone. Authentication tokens check which the end users are who they claim for being and that they've got access legal rights for that individual API connect with.

Security see: We are getting to be aware about a protection challenge Which may be impacting Internet websites using particular 3rd-bash libraries (together with polyfill.io). This issue can in some cases redirect visitors from the meant Web page with no website operator understanding or authorization.

An API designer can be a standards-informed Software that supports the development of the API specification. It may be as simple as a plugin for an built-in improvement natural environment (IDE), such as Visible Studio Code, or you can use equipment such as Apiary and Swagger, which will allow you to use guidelines for validating and formatting the specification.

This is often accomplished because autoplaying audio is frequently genuinely frustrating and we really should not be subjecting our people to it.

Relaxation (Representational Point out Transfer) APIs really are a set of rules and constraints for building Website companies that happen to be simple to use and scalable. They use standard HTTP solutions for instance GET, Publish, Set, and DELETE for interaction and therefore are stateless, meaning Each and every request from the consumer to a server need to include all the information necessary to understand and method the request. Relaxation APIs are greatly utilised because of their simplicity, overall flexibility, and ability to work about the internet.

Making use of APIs is commonly made simpler by using deals delivered as part of a programming language or frameworks what is api mean like Spring for Java. Many of the frameworks out there also occur for being open up supply jobs.

Creating an API includes various key measures to be certain it is effectively-created, functional, and convenient to use. Below’s a guideline regarding how to generate an API:

The evolution in API technologies and adoption has resulted in a collection of related API resources remaining made, which have progressed into a normal architecture and attributes.

The vacation assistance does this by interacting While using the airline’s API, letting the travel assistance to obtain facts for his or her database to guide selections like seats, baggage, together with other lodging. That API will acquire what it identified, insert the response, and provide it again to you personally to fulfill your ask for With all the related facts you’re searching for. 

For instance, a few of the much more present day WebAPIs will only work on internet pages served about HTTPS resulting from them transmitting likely delicate facts (examples include Company Staff and Push).

Retail companies use APIs with courier networks guaranteeing that deals and orders are sent and placed. Net apps and streaming expert services also make the most of APIs to connect their entrance-conclude person content with vital back again-finish functionality to distribute content. 

They allow developers to immediately combine certain features into their applications or Web-site. You can find Many Public APIs on RapidAPI; discover the one that should help electrical power your subsequent undertaking to the RapidAPI Hub.

APIs tend to be the paths that hold our technological environment jointly, by connecting techniques and procedures for all persons and companies to accomplish their requests.  

Leave a Reply

Your email address will not be published. Required fields are marked *